With the fantasy baseball calendar flipping to Week 3, waiver-wire activity is intensifying as managers look for short-term pitching boosts and emerging arms showing new pitch mixes. Industry coverage from NBC Sports, ESPN, Yahoo Sports and CBS Sports converges on a handful of names—headlined by top prospects Jack Leiter and Taj Bradley—whose arsenal tweaks and two-start opportunities could swing weekly matchups.
NBC Sports leads Monday’s discussion by flagging Leiter and Bradley as prime streamer targets, noting that both right-handers have recently altered their pitch arsenals in ways that could yield immediate strikeout upside. While the outlet does not detail the exact changes, the mere mention of arsenal adjustments for two high-profile arms is enough to send fantasy managers scouring for recent video or minor-league data.
ESPN’s daily lineup column echoes the streaming theme, recommending Casey Mize and top prospect Andrew Painter as the best pitching pickups for Monday’s slate. The piece frames Mize as a volume play with a favorable park factor, while Painter’s electric stuff is positioned as a high-risk, high-reward dice roll for those chasing ratios and whiffs.
Yahoo Sports doubles down on quantity by publishing its weekly Two-Start Pitcher Rankings, placing a pair of Kansas City Royals hurlers at the top of the waiver-wire list. The identities of those Royals starters are withheld in the summary, but the ranking underscores the inherent value of dual starts in head-to-head formats.
CBS Sports, meanwhile, pivots to deeper sleepers, unveiling a Week 3 top-10 sleeper pitcher list that spotlights Angels righty Jose Soriano and White Sox swingman Reynaldo Lopez. Both arms are projected for favorable matchups and could be available in more than half of standard leagues.
Finally, Yahoo’s advanced-stats waiver wire column advises owners to exploit specific hitter matchups, though the precise batters are not disclosed in the provided text. The emphasis remains on streaming—whether on the mound or at the plate—guided by underlying metrics rather than surface numbers.
Bottom line: if you need pitching this week, the consensus is clear—target the Royals’ two-start duo, monitor Leiter and Bradley for arsenal-related breakouts, and don’t overlook Soriano or Lopez as low-owned lottery tickets.
